Collect all information related to the development of Ethereum technology

INTRO to introduce

Introduction to Started

  • Blockchain Technology Guide A systematic introduction to the blockchain field
  • What is Ethereum? What is a smart contract? Ethereum smart Contract introduction concept
  • Understanding blockchain Key points of blockchain
  • (a) simple to understand what is the blockchain bitcoin blockchain keywords explain
  • (2) simple to understand what is blockchain (technology) Bitcoin blockchain technology diagram
  • Understand the block chain architecture design from the technical layer deconstruction architecture

Ethereum advanced

  • Ethereum White Paper
  • The Ethereum Wiki (English)
  • Ethereum official documentation Chinese version
  • Used by Ethereum Gas Calculating Costs in Ethereum Contracts (English)
  • Ethereum code anatomy
  • Ethereum source code to read

TUTORIAL TUTORIAL

Ethereum etheric fang

  • Ethbox, one click install ethereum local development environment – Windows
  • Ethereum DApp development tutorial – Voting system
  • Ethereum Dapp and smart contract development primer
  • Ethereum e-commerce tutorial Ethereum IPSF, Node.js, Mongodb to build e-commerce platform combat
  • Build and deploy ethereum smart contracts using Remix
  • Solidity Validation of Elliptic Curve Encrypted Digital Signatures
  • Create your own crypto-currencyFrom the official ethereum token creation tutorial(English)
  • ETHEREUM PET SHOPTruffle framework step-by-step case tutorial(English)
  • ROBUST SMART CONTRACTS WITH OPENZEPPELINOpenZeppelin integrates with Truffle to write robust and secure contracts(English)
  • Truffle3.0 case tutorialIntegrate NodeJS and run completely, with detailed examples and possible errors(English)

Videos video

  • Building Ethereum DApps using SolidityVideo tutorial(English)
  • Devcon 0 (Berlin, 2014) talks and videos (English)
  • Devcon 1 (London, 2015) talks and videos (English)
  • Devcon 2 (Shanghai, 2016) talks and videos (English)
  • Devcon 3 (Cancún, 2017) website and registration (English)

The PROJECT PROJECT

Chain blockchain bottom layer

  • Metaverse original boundary chain source code
  • EOS EOS chain source code
  • BYTOM than the original chain source code
  • CITA CITA alliance chain at the bottom of the source
  • Bitcoin 0.1 is the original bitcoin code
  • Blockbench blockchain performance testing tool
  • Quorum comes from JP Morgan’s data privacy enhancement Ethereum implementation based on Go-Ethereum
  • BCOS comes from an enhanced ethereum implementation of Webank
  • Presto-Ethereum adds SQL access to Presto
  • IPFS Implementation principle of the IPFS GO language

The SDK toolkit

  • Remix browser compiler
  • Truffle Ethereum Dapp development scaffolding
  • Zeppelin was used to write a secure ethereum contract framework
  • Web3j Ethereum official Web3 Lightweight Java SDK
  • Embark Ethereum Dapp development framework, supporting IPFS, Whisper, and Orbit calls
  • Web3Swift A Swift SDK for Web3
  • Pore decompiles the Ethereum smart contract tool
  • Solidity-Coverage Tests Solidity code Coverage
  • Composer official Visual Fabric application development framework
  • Cakeshop comes from JP Morgan’s Ethereum visual management tool
  • Zokrates Ethereum using zkSNARKS toolkit (experimental)
  • Libsnark zkSNARKS c + + library

The DOCUMENT information

Ethereum etheric fang

  • Mastering Ethereum development Oreilly Open Source Book
  • Ethereum tech blog focuses on Ethereum
  • Solidity language learning for Ethereum series tutorials
  • Solidity Language document Language Chinese manual
  • Introduction to Ethereum smart Contracts
  • Web3. Js manual
  • Web3.js 1.0 Chinese Manual Interface Chinese manual
  • Ipfs command manual
  • Ethplorer Interface Ethplorer interface document
  • Ethereum Smart Contract Security Best Practices (english)
  • Ethereum Sharding FAQ
  • Node.js blockchain development
  • Geth User Guide Chinese version
  • Ethereum DApp development environment -Ubuntu
  • Ethereum DApp development environment setup – Windows
  • Ethereum DApp development private chain construction -Ubuntu
  • Ethereum DApp development private chain construction – Windows
  • Description of ethereum Ganache CLI parameters
  • Deploy ethereum contracts using Truflle and Infura
  • IPFS installation, deployment and development environment – Windows
  • Ethereum FAQ

APPLICATION APPLICATION

Browse the Explorer chain

  • Etherscan Ethereum blockchain browser
  • Ethplorer Ethereum blockchain browser, provides API calls
  • Eth Gas Station Ethereum Gas is currently priced

Wallet Wallet

  • My Ether Wallet web edition ethereum Wallet source code
  • MetaMask Chrome Extension
  • The Multi-Platform Jaxx Wallet is compatible with both Ethereum and Bitcoin wallets
  • Mist Wallet official Lightweight Wallet
  • Parity Wallet
  • Harmony Wallet
  • ImToken Mobile App wallet
  • Trust iOS/Android native Wallet + DApp browser
  • Cipher iOS/Android wallet + DApp browser
  • Ledger Nano S Hardware wallet
  • Trezor hardware wallet

Social society

  • Oraclize third party information provider
  • Aragon company business source code
  • Dharma third party enhanced source code
  • Chronobank sharing mechanism
  • Slockit rental smart device source code
  • DAO DAO proposal

Exchange Exchange

  • 0X 0X exchange source code
  • Ethdelf Etherdelta exchange source code
  • Dmarket Dmarket exchange source code
  • Augur betting exchange source code
  • Melonport digital asset exchange source code

Cross Chain across the Chain

  • Cosmos Cross-chain transaction, including BTC to ETH source code
  • Polkadot Polkadot cross-chain, implemented a lightweight Ethereum client source

Token tokens,

  • ERC20 Ethereum’S ICO token standard
  • Token Sale model
  • Maker Dai scrip